Determining the absolute "leader" can be subjective, as different platforms cater to various needs. However, we can explore some strong contenders in the UK DeFi market based on factors like:

  • Total Value Locked (TVL): This metric indicates the total amount of cryptocurrency deposited in the platform's smart contracts. A higher TVL signifies greater user trust and platform activity.
  • Supported DeFi Services: The wider range of services offered, such as lending, borrowing, staking, and token swaps, makes the platform more versatile.
  • User Interface (UI) and User Experience (UX): A user-friendly interface is crucial for attracting and retaining users, especially those new to DeFi.
  • Security and Regulations: Robust security measures and adherence to UK regulations inspire confidence in users.

Exploring the Platforms:

  • Kine: This platform stands out for its focus on derivative trading, a feature not commonly found in DeFi exchanges. Kine also boasts minimal fees and staking rewards, making it attractive for active traders and long-term investors.
  • Uniswap: As a leading decentralized exchange, Uniswap allows users to swap tokens directly with each other, eliminating the need for centralized exchanges. Its global reach makes it a popular choice for UK-based DeFi users.
  • AAVE: This lending protocol facilitates borrowing and lending of crypto assets. AAVE offers competitive interest rates based on supply and demand, making it a flexible solution for earning passive income or accessing crypto liquidity.
  • Compound: Similar to AAVE, Compound allows users to earn interest on their crypto holdings or borrow assets. However, Compound is known for its innovative governance model, where COMP token holders can vote on changes to the platform's protocol.
